The Anatomy of an AF Football Uniform: What Makes It Tick?

Alright, guys, let's get down to the nitty-gritty. What exactly makes up an AF football uniform? It's more than just a jersey and pants, believe me. It's a carefully crafted ensemble designed for both performance and aesthetics. The main components include:

  • The Jersey: This is the star of the show, typically made from durable, breathable materials like polyester or a blend. It features the team's colors, logo, and the player's number. Some jerseys also include the player's name on the back. Think about it – the jersey is the most visible part of the uniform, so it's all about making a statement.
  • The Pants: Often made from the same tough materials as the jersey, the pants need to withstand a lot of wear and tear. They usually include padding in the hips, thighs, and knees to protect the players. The style can vary – some teams opt for a classic straight-leg look, while others go for a more modern, streamlined fit.
  • The Helmet: This is your best friend when you're playing football, and it’s a crucial safety component. Helmets are designed to protect the head from impact. They are adorned with the team's logo and can also feature a face mask for added protection. The design of the helmet can vary from team to team, often reflecting their brand identity.
  • Shoulder Pads: These are worn under the jersey and provide essential protection for the shoulders and upper chest. Shoulder pads can vary in size and design depending on the player's position, as different positions have different needs for mobility and protection.
  • Socks and Cleats: These might seem like small details, but they're super important. Socks provide cushioning and comfort, while cleats give players the grip they need to run, cut, and change direction on the field. The cleats are specifically designed for the type of playing surface, whether it's grass or artificial turf.

So, as you can see, an AF football uniform is a complex piece of equipment, meticulously designed to protect players while also reflecting the team's identity. From the materials used to the padding and design elements, every aspect serves a purpose. It's not just about looking good, guys; it's about performing at your best.

Evolution of AF Football Uniforms: From Leather Helmets to High-Tech Gear

Alright, let's take a trip down memory lane. How have AF football uniforms changed over the years? The evolution of these uniforms is a fascinating journey through sports history, reflecting advancements in technology, design trends, and safety regulations.

Back in the early days of football, things were pretty basic. Players often wore wool jerseys and leather helmets, which offered minimal protection. The uniforms were bulky, and the focus was more on function than form. The colors were often simple, and the designs were relatively plain. Can you imagine playing a game in a heavy wool jersey? Yikes!

As the sport evolved, so did the uniforms. The introduction of synthetic materials like nylon and polyester revolutionized the game. These materials were lighter, more durable, and more breathable than wool, improving player comfort and performance. Helmets got a major upgrade, too, with the introduction of hard plastic shells and face masks, significantly increasing player safety.

The 1960s and 70s saw some bold design choices. Teams experimented with brighter colors, bolder stripes, and more elaborate logos. The uniforms became a way for teams to express their personalities and connect with their fans. Think of the iconic designs of the era – they're instantly recognizable and still beloved today.

Fast forward to the present, and we're in the age of high-tech gear. Modern AF football uniforms are designed using advanced fabrics that wick away sweat, regulate body temperature, and offer maximum flexibility. The padding is lighter and more effective, and helmets are equipped with cutting-edge technology to absorb impact and reduce the risk of concussions. The designs are more streamlined, with a focus on both aesthetics and performance. The trend is moving towards more integrated designs, where the padding is built directly into the uniform, providing a seamless and streamlined look. The materials are also becoming more sustainable, with some manufacturers using recycled materials to reduce their environmental impact.

So, from wool to high-tech synthetics, the journey of the AF football uniform reflects the evolution of the sport itself. Each era has brought its own unique style and innovations, always striving to improve player safety, comfort, and performance. Pretty cool, right?

AF Football Uniforms: Beyond the Basics – Special Editions and Alternate Designs

Ready to get a little creative? AF football uniforms aren’t always about sticking to the traditional look. Teams love to mix things up with special editions and alternate designs! Let's explore some of these variations:

  • Throwback Uniforms: These are a fan favorite! Throwback uniforms are designed to pay homage to the team's history. They often feature designs from previous eras, giving fans a nostalgic look at the team's past. You might see a team sporting a uniform from the 1960s or 70s, complete with the vintage logo and colors. It's a fun way to celebrate the team's legacy and connect with older fans.
  • Color Rush Uniforms: Remember those super vibrant, monochromatic uniforms? That's what Color Rush is all about! These designs feature a single dominant color, often with bold accents. They're designed to be eye-catching and memorable. Some teams have embraced the Color Rush concept with enthusiasm, creating some truly unique and striking looks.
  • Military Appreciation Uniforms: In a show of support for the armed forces, some teams will wear special uniforms with military-inspired designs. These uniforms often feature camouflage patterns, military insignias, and colors that represent different branches of the military. It's a way for the team to honor and thank those who serve.
  • Special Event Uniforms: For major events like the Super Bowl or a special anniversary, teams might unveil a special uniform. These designs are often limited edition and can be highly sought after by fans. They might feature unique logos, special patches, or a completely different design aesthetic.
  • Alternate Uniforms: Many teams have an alternate uniform that they wear occasionally. These designs can range from subtle variations on the team's primary uniform to completely new looks. Alternate uniforms allow teams to experiment with different colors and designs, giving them a fresh look on the field.

These variations demonstrate the creativity that goes into AF football uniform design. Special editions and alternate designs keep things fresh and exciting for fans. They also give teams a chance to express their personality and connect with different audiences.

The Future of AF Football Uniforms: What's Next?

So, what's on the horizon for AF football uniforms? The future is bright, guys, with exciting developments in technology, design, and sustainability:

  • Smart Fabrics: Imagine uniforms that can monitor a player's vital signs and provide real-time data on their performance. Smart fabrics are on the way, potentially incorporating sensors that track heart rate, body temperature, and even the force of impacts. This data could be used to improve player safety, optimize training, and enhance performance.
  • Adaptive Designs: Expect to see uniforms that adapt to the player's needs. This could involve materials that change their properties depending on the weather conditions, or padding that adjusts to provide optimal protection. The goal is to create uniforms that are as comfortable and effective as possible.
  • 3D Printing: 3D printing is already making waves in various industries, and it's set to revolutionize uniform design. It could be used to create custom-fit padding, helmets, and even entire uniforms, allowing for unprecedented levels of personalization and performance.
  • Sustainable Materials: With increasing awareness of environmental issues, we'll see more emphasis on sustainable materials. This could involve using recycled fabrics, bio-based materials, and production processes that minimize waste. The goal is to create uniforms that are both high-performing and environmentally friendly.
  • Enhanced Safety Features: Player safety will always be a top priority. We can expect to see further advancements in helmet technology, with the development of materials that absorb more impact and reduce the risk of concussions. Uniforms may also incorporate padding that provides enhanced protection for specific areas of the body.

So, the future of AF football uniforms is all about innovation, performance, and sustainability. As technology advances, we can expect to see uniforms that are more comfortable, safer, and better suited to the needs of the players. The game is constantly evolving, and the uniforms are right there with it.
